Response of pelvic inflammatory disease to pulsed electromagnetic therapy /
Dina Essam Ebraheem Eltersawy
Response of pelvic inflammatory disease to pulsed electromagnetic therapy / إستجابة إلتهابات الحوض للعلاج الكهرومغناطيسى المتقطع Dina Essam Ebraheem Eltersawy ; Supervised Salwa Mostafa Elbadry , Hanan Elsayed Elmekawy , Ahmed Abdellatef Mohram - Cairo : Dina Essam Ebraheem Eltersawy , 2013 - 103 P. : charts , facsimiles ; 25cm
Thesis (Ph.D.) - Cairo University - Faculty of Physical Therapy - Department of Physical Therapy for Gynecology and Obstetrics
This study was conducted to evaluate the response of pelvic inflammatory disease to pulsed electronagnetic therapy. Sixty patients complaining from mild to moderate degrees of pelvic inflammatory disease were participated in this study. Patients were assigned randomly into two groups equal in numbers. Group (A) study group received pulsed electromagnetic therapy with frequency of 20 HZ, intensity of 40 gauss and duration of 20 minutes per session, 3 sessions per week for 6 weeks in addition to routine medical treatment fluoroquinolones 500 milligram plus metronidazole 500 milligram each of them orally twice per day at the morning and at the evening for 2 weeks
